Excerpted from Les Sei gneurs de Bohon by Jean LeMelletier, Coutances:
Arnaud-Bellee, 1978: Henry de Bohon (1176-1220), earl of Hereford,played an important role in the revolt of the barons against KingJohn. Born in 1176, he succeeded his grandfather honorab ly. The reignof King John (1199-1216) started out well for Henry when he wascre ated earl of Hereford on 28 April 1199. Henry was the first of theBohons to hav e the title, which included an
annual income. The following year Henry and other nobles summoned hisuncle in Scotland, William the Lion, to appear at Lincoln to dohomage. In 1203 Henry witnessed a document where King John confirmedthe d owry of Queen Isabelle. The principal interests of the Bohonswere in England. H enry paid taxes of 50 marks and a groom,corresponding to 20 parts of a knight's fee, on the Huntington land heinherited from his mother. In Normandy, Henry ke pt his more modestholdings (from Humphrey I) at Carentan and Pont D'Ouve. After thefirst time France reclaimed Normandy (1204), Henry stayed loyal toJohn. His lands in Normandy were confiscated by Philip- Auguste. ThenKing John imposed a heavy tax to maintain the campaign of 1213-1214 toprevent the crushing of a co alition formed at Bouvines on 27 July 1214by England, Flanders, and the German Empire. The king was discreditedand there was
general discontent. The forces w ere dissatisfied that the king awardedcertain barons without their having to go through the regular testsand examinations.
Then there was a revolt of barons in which Henry took an active part.The revolt ended with the signing of the Mag na Carta at Runnymede(Surrey) on 12 July 1215. The lands that had been confisca ted fromHenry were returned and the 25 lords took it upon themselves to makesur e the charter was enforced. The Bohons enjoyed being in possessionof great land s at the frontier of the Welsh country which was alwaysthreatened. The other ma rcher lords enjoyed it, too, because theirmilitary importance and independence was greater than that of otherroyal lords. Politically they were stronger by be ing closer to theking. The lull was cut short when the war restarted. The follo wingyear John had Pope Innocent III excommunicate the earl of Hereford,which on ly increased the opposition to the king. John joined forceswith the army of Pri nce Louis of France (the future Louis VIII) whenbarons from the north landed in England.
John died on October 19, 1216, but Henry de Bohon did not ally himse lfwith the new king, Henry III. He was taken prisoner at the Battle ofLincoln o n 20 May 1217, where Louis of France was defeated. Henrygave the churches of B oxe and Wilsford (Lincolnshire) to the priory ofMonkton Farley, and
gave a pen sion to St. Nicolas Hospital in Salisbury. Henry de Bohondied 1 June 1220 whil e on a pilgrimage to the Holy Land. His body wasreturned
to Lanthony abbey.

Excerpted from Les Seigneurs de Bohon by Jea n LeMelletier, Coutances:
Arnaud-Bellee, 1978: Humphrey III, lord of Trowbridg e and constable ofEngland, was very close to Henry I and later Henry II. He ass istedEmpress Mathilda against King Stephen. Born in 1109, Humphrey died 6April 1187. He married Margery (Marguerite, Margaret), eldest daughterof Milo of Glou cester from whom he received the heriditary right tothe title of constable of E ngland.
Humphrey III was steward and chancellor to Henry I, perhaps followingh is father. He shared this post with Hugh Bigot/Bigod, Robert Haye,and Simon de Beauchamp. Sometimes he is confused with his father. Wecan follow Humphrey III in the entourage of King Henry I by thedocuments he signed at
Arques and Diepp e (1131), various English towns (1131-1133), inNormandy at Rouen (1133 & 1134), and at Argentan (about the sametime). When Steven of Blois, earl of Mortain, grandson of William theConqueror and Adele, was
crowned king of England after Henry I died (1135), Humphrey kept hisduties as steward presiding over charters . Two were written at Evreuxin 1137. One concerned infractions against God; the other gave land inBramford (Suffolk) to St. Mary d'Evreux. In 1139 Empress Mat hildaarrived in Sussex with her her half-brother, Robert of Gloucester, torecla im the inheritance of his father.
Humphrey, at the instigation of his father-i n-law, Milo de Gloucester,rallied with Mathilda and defended Trowbridge against King Steven.During the troublesome years of the anarchy that followed, Humphre ypassionately fought with Mathilda's loyal and true followers. Hewitnessed Milo being named earl of Hereford in recognition of his(Milo's) services on 25 July 1141. Humphrey's signature is found onseveral documents in many English villag es. After initial success, theBattle of Winchester (1141) marked a turnaround a nd Humphrey was takenprisoner. In 1143 in Devizes (Wiltshire), Mathilda reinsta tedpossession of lands and the office of chancellor of England to Henryin a wri tten document. She also gave him new wealth and land:Melchesam,
Boczam, Malmes bury, and Stokes-Wiltshire. (Humphrey had been relievedof his duties after the reign of Henry I.) Humphrey signed a documentof Prince Henry in 1149/1150 at D evizes and another in 1150/1151 atArgentan. In 1150 Trowbridge Castle was taken by Stephen. When theabbey church of Montebourg was dedicated in 1152, Humphrey consentedto the gift of the church of St. Gregoire de Catz by Ildebert de Catz and Steven de Magneville. After the death of his father, GeoffreyPlantagenet (1 153), Henry was in England leading the army. Henry madean agreement with Steph en when Eustache, Stephen's son, died, wherebyHenry would succeed him to the th rone when he died (the next year).Henry II then confirmed Humphrey's inheritanc es in England andNormandy and his titles. Because of his role as lord chancello r andhis signatures on numerous documents, we are able to account forHumphrey's whereabouts. He was in England with the king (1153-1154);in Normandy (1156) at Argentan, Falaise, and Quevilly (1174); with hispeers in Chinon (1170-1173); b ack in England (between 1174-1179); andagain in Normandy at Valognes, Cherbourg , and Bonneville-sur-Touques(1180 & 1182).
In January 1164 Humphrey was one of the barons summoned to the Councilof Clarendon where the constitutions were dr awn up. In April 1173 whenPrince Henry rebelled against his father, King Henry II, Humphreystood by the king. Excerpted from Les Seigneurs de Bohon by Jean LeMelletier , Coutances:
Arnaud-Bellee, 1978: Born in 1109, Humphrey died 6 April 1187. H emarried Margery (Marguerite, Margaret), eldest daughter of Milo ofGloucester f rom whom he received the heriditary right to the title ofconstable of England. Humphrey's fortune considerably increased withthe death of his father- in-law, Milo of Gloucester, who without maleheirs left a third of his wealth to each da ughter. Humphrey alsoinherited the position of constable of England that was he ld by hisfather-in-law. In 1166 Humphrey inherited 3 1/2 parts of a knight'sfee s (rent) from his grandfather's provinces and 9 1/2 parts "denovo." Excerpted from Les Seigneurs de Bohon by Jean LeMelletier, Coutances :
Arnaud-Bellee, 1978: According the the chronicle of Lanthony, HumphreyIV was earl of Hereford and constable of England. But he died beforehis father, proba bly in 1182 in France while serving Henry theyounger, so he never had the title s. Humphrey was married to Margaretof Scotland (who died 1201), daughter of Hen ry, earl of Huntington,and sister of King William the Lion of Scotland, and wid ow of Conan lePetit, earl of Brittany and Richmond (who died 1171). AfterHumph rey's death, his widow confirmed the gift of a marketplace to thepriory of Brad enstoke that he had specified in his will.
